ALEXANDRIA, Va., May 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,636,049, issued on May 26, was assigned to Stryker European Operations Ltd. (Carrigtwohill, Ireland).
"Intermediate femoral nail" was invented by Sabine Bigdeli-Issazadeh (Felde, Germany).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A femoral nail includes a proximal portion configured to engage a driving tool for driving the femoral nail into a femur, a distal portion remote from the proximal portion, and an intermediate portion extending from and between the proximal portion and distal portion.
